三维声波散射的时域仿真
Time Domain Simulation of Three Dimensional Acoustic Scattering

In order to study the dynamic wave scattering in medical ultrasonic diagnosis, the finitedifference time domain method is applied to solve the three-dimensional acoustic scattering in time domain.Three-dimensional model of the velocity-stress staggered-grid finite-difference on acoustic waves has been established. The construction of perfectly matched layer (PML) is discussed, and the finite-difference scheme of the PML boundary conditions is implemented. The property of the PML is analyzed. Active simulation of the scattering of standard three-dimensional object has been finished. Numerical experiments have proved the effectiveness of the proposed algorithm.关键词
